An unnamed gentleman, who says he is located somewhere in far north Queensland, Australia, operates a fascinating YouTube channel under the title, Primitive Technologies.

In a nutshell, he builds a fairly sturdy and weather-proof grass hut in this video, apparently using nothing but the environment around him. Clearing a flat space on the forest floor with just his hands and feet, he sets about making the hut foundation with branches and vine-made ropes. He uses sharpened stones to cut clumps of dried grass for the walls before tying it all together.

The end result is a bush palace fit for any apocalypse or accidental bush walk gone wrong.
